LTV (Lifetime Value)

LTV stands for Lifetime Value and expresses the total revenue a company expects to earn from a customer over the entire customer relationship. The figure accounts for average purchase value, purchase frequency and how long the customer stays. LTV is often used together with CAC to assess whether it is profitable to acquire more customers.

A webshop whose customers spend an average of $30 four times a year over three years has an LTV of $360 per customer.
